2005 Citroen Xsara vs. 1990 Renault Clio

To start off, 2005 Citroen Xsara is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1990 Renault Clio.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1990 Renault Clio would be higher. At 1,749 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Citroen Xsara is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Citroen Xsara (114 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 35 more horse power than 1990 Renault Clio. (79 HP @ 5750 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Citroen Xsara should accelerate faster than 1990 Renault Clio.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Citroen Xsara weights approximately 485 kg more than 1990 Renault Clio.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Citroen Xsara (160 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 53 more torque (in Nm) than 1990 Renault Clio. (107 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 2005 Citroen Xsara will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1990 Renault Clio.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Citroen Xsara 1990 Renault Clio
Make Citroen Renault
Model Xsara Clio
Year Released 2005 1990
Body Type Hatchback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1749 cc 1390 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 114 HP 79 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 5750 RPM
Torque 160 Nm 107 Nm
Torque RPM 4000 RPM 3500 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 11.0:1 9.5:1
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 1325 kg 840 kg
Vehicle Length 4280 mm 3710 mm
Vehicle Width 1760 mm 1630 mm
Vehicle Height 1640 mm 1400 mm
